Hamilton streetscapes are ever-changing.

Businesses come and go. Roads transform from two-way to one-way, and back again. Rooflines creep closer to the clouds.

And memories of what the city once looked like begin to fade.

As a reminder of how much things have changed, The Spectator has recreated archival photos of Hamilton streetscapes.

Pictured here is Wilson Street in Ancaster as it appeared in 1952 and today.
